Everend Posted February 26, 2021 Share Posted February 26, 2021 (edited) Install worked well but have trouble changing the admin password. The new password works as well as the old default password. Seems this is a known issue from a couple years ago, still looking for the resolution. Edit: This seems to be a resolution. https://github.com/airsonic/airsonic/issues/733#issuecomment-384286666 Edit: Problem solved. within the WebUI, click on the user tab, select the admin user, click the add credentials checkbox to put in the new password. Then click on the Credentials tab and remove the old one from the list. Edited February 26, 2021 by Everend 1 Link to comment

Squid Posted June 6, 2021 Share Posted June 6, 2021 Yes. Trust what I said You had the paths on the template mapped correctly before Container Path /media mapped to host path /mnt/user/music Within airsonic you set the path for music to be /media. Is iTunes a subfolder off of the music share? (and is the regular music also a subfolder?) If no, then get rid of the itunes line. If yes, then set Music to be /media/musicFolder and iTunes to be /media/iTunesFolder This might also help you understand path mappings 1 Link to comment
